Why Choose Mesh Wifi

Mesh wifi systems use multiple devices to spread wifi evenly in your home. This helps avoid weak signals and dead spots.

They are good for homes with many devices that need strong and steady internet connections.

Benefits For Multi-device Homes

Mesh wifi supports many devices at the same time without slowing down the network. This is key for homes with phones, laptops, and smart devices.

It also makes it easy to add more devices later without losing speed or coverage.

  • Connect many devices smoothly
  • Automatic connection to the strongest signal
  • Easy to expand network range
  • Stable connection during video calls and streaming

Coverage Vs Speed

Mesh wifi gives better coverage than a single router. It spreads wifi signals across your home using several units.

Each device works together to keep your internet fast, even far from the main router.

  • Wide coverage for large or multi-story homes
  • Consistent speed throughout the house
  • Less signal drop in hard-to-reach areas
  • Improved overall internet reliability

Speed And Performance

Speed affects how fast you can browse, stream, and download. Pick a mesh wifi with strong wifi standards and good data rates.

  • Look for wifi 5 (802.11ac) or wifi 6 (802.11ax) support.
  • Check the maximum speed in Mbps or Gbps.
  • Consider systems with multiple bands for less interference.

Security Features

Secure your home network with strong protections. Look for features that keep hackers out and protect your data.

Key Security Features to Check:
  • WPA3 encryption for better wireless security
  • Automatic firmware updates to fix bugs and risks
  • Guest network options to separate visitors
  • Parental controls to manage device access

Setup Tips For Optimal Performance

Setting up mesh WiFi correctly helps keep your home network fast. Proper placement and device settings improve signal strength. Follow these simple tips for the best results.

Good setup supports many devices without slowdowns. Avoid common mistakes to get smooth internet everywhere in your home.

Ideal Router Placement

Place the main router in a central location. This spot helps the signal reach all rooms evenly. Keep it off the floor and away from thick walls.

  • Choose an open area with few obstructions
  • Elevate the router on a shelf or table
  • Keep routers away from metal objects and mirrors
  • Position satellite nodes where the main signal is strong

Avoiding Interference

Other electronics can block WiFi signals. Keep your mesh devices clear of interference for steady connections. Some devices cause more problems than others.

DeviceDistance to KeepReason
Microwave OvenAt least 3 feetEmits signals that disrupt WiFi
Cordless Phone2-3 feetShares radio frequencies with WiFi
Bluetooth DevicesAway from main nodesCan cause signal overlap
Baby MonitorSeparate room if possibleOperates on WiFi bands

Configuring Devices

Set up your mesh system to support many devices. Use the right settings to reduce lag and keep connections stable.

  1. Assign unique names to each node for easy management
  2. Update firmware regularly to improve performance
  3. Use the 5 GHz band for devices close to nodes
  4. Connect far devices to the 2.4 GHz band for better range
  5. Enable automatic channel selection to avoid busy frequencies

Troubleshooting Common Issues

Mesh WiFi systems under $200 can support many devices in your home. Sometimes, you may face connection problems. This guide helps you fix common issues quickly.

Understanding these problems helps keep your network fast and stable. Follow these tips to solve slow speeds, connection drops, and device compatibility troubles.

Slow Speeds

Slow internet can happen even with a mesh WiFi system. It may be due to distance, interference, or too many devices using the network.

Try moving your mesh nodes closer together. Also, reduce the number of active devices or pause large downloads to improve speed.

  • Place nodes in open areas, not behind walls
  • Limit devices streaming videos or gaming
  • Restart your router and mesh nodes regularly
  • Check for firmware updates to improve speed

Connection Drops

Connection drops can interrupt your online work or entertainment. Causes include weak signals, interference, or outdated hardware.

Keep mesh nodes within range and away from electronics that cause interference. Restart devices to refresh connections.

  • Avoid placing nodes near microwaves or cordless phones
  • Use 5GHz band for faster and more stable connections
  • Update router and device software often
  • Check cables and power sources for faults

Device Compatibility

Some devices may not work well with certain mesh WiFi systems. Older gadgets might not support new WiFi standards.

Make sure your devices have the latest updates. Check your mesh WiFi manual for supported device lists and compatibility tips.

  • Update device firmware and WiFi drivers
  • Use 2.4GHz band for older devices
  • Reset device network settings if problems persist
  • Consult manufacturer support for specific issues

How Many Devices Can Mesh Wifi Support Simultaneously?

Most mesh WiFi systems under $200 support 20-50 devices simultaneously. This ensures smooth streaming, gaming, and browsing across smartphones, laptops, and smart home gadgets. The actual capacity depends on the mesh model and internet speed.
